Enter & View Information

Who Cares are currently looking for volunteers to take on the important role of becoming enter and view representatives.

Who Cares has the right by law to appoint voluntary representatives to enter and view adult health and social care premises. Appointed volunteers have the ability to oversee the delivery of health and social care services in these premises, and gather feedback from those receiving the services. These visits will take place as part of pre-arranged and coordinated visits

The role requires a number of skills, but full training will be given to all successful applicants. An enhanced Criminal Records Bureau check will also need to be carried out, but this will be paid for by Who Cares host organisation Voluntary Action North Lincolnshire.
